A Level 2 Electrician isn't your daily sparky. While a basic electrician might handle internal circuitry, lighting installations, and power point repair work, the Level 2 professional operates on a different plane, authorised to work straight on the service network infrastructure. This consists of overhead and underground service lines, metering equipment, and the vital connections that bring power from the street to a customer's facilities. They are the ones you call when your service fuse blows, when you require a new power pole set up, or when you're updating your switchboard to deal with increased power demands. Their work is often performed at height, underground, or in close proximity to live wires, requiring an intense awareness of risk and a meticulous adherence to security procedures.

The journey to ending up being a Level 2 Electrician is a difficult however gratifying one, requiring substantial devotion. It usually begins with finishing a Certificate III in Electrotechnology Electrician, followed by a number of years of practical experience as a certified electrician. This fundamental knowledge then leads the way for specialised training and evaluation that covers the particular subtleties of dealing with the service network. Ambitious Level 2 professionals should show efficiency in locations such as overhead service work, underground service work, metering, and disconnections/reconnections. This rigorous training guarantees they possess the required proficiency to handle complicated situations securely and effectively, often including live electrical parts where a single mistake might have severe repercussions.

Their competence encompasses a broad range of critical services. When a brand-new home is built, it's the Level 2 Electrician who connects it to the mains power supply, installing the meter and ensuring all required safety checks are carried out. Similarly, if a home undergoes substantial renovation or requires an upgrade to its electrical capability, these are the professionals who evaluate the existing infrastructure, carry out the necessary upgrades to theboard, and guarantee the entire system can safely handle the increased load. They are likewise instrumental in emergency circumstances, responding to power blackouts, fixing storm-damaged lines, and remedying concerns that jeopardize the integrity of the power supply. Their swift and decisive actions in these scenarios are vital in restoring power and reducing interruption for homeowners and companies.

Beyond new setups and repair work, Level 2 Electricians play a crucial function in maintaining the existing electrical facilities. They perform routine examinations, recognize potential threats, and click here carry out preventative maintenance to alleviate threats and extend the life-span of electrical elements. This proactive technique is crucial in avoiding expensive breakdowns and ensuring the continued reliability of the power supply. Their work is carefully documented and complies with stringent industry standards and regulations, ensuring compliance and accountability in all their operations.
